Myanmar Junta Recaptures Mawtaung Border Town, Displacing 4,000
Following a 15-day counteroffensive supported by airstrikes and artillery, Myanmar military forces recaptured the Thai border trading town of Mawtaung from the Karen National Liberation Army (KNLA). The heavy fighting forced at least 4,000 civilians from the town and nine surrounding villages to flee towards the border and nearby forests.
